我正在尝试制作一个具有文本字段且自动对焦设置为true的底页,以便弹出键盘。但是,底片被键盘覆盖。有没有办法将bottomsheet移到键盘上方?Padding(padding:EdgeInsets.only(bottom:MediaQuery.of(context).viewInsets.bottom),child:Column(children:[TextField(autofocus:true,decoration:InputDecoration(hintText:'Title'),),TextField(decoration:InputDecoration(hintText:'
我正在尝试制作一个具有文本字段且自动对焦设置为true的底页,以便弹出键盘。但是,底片被键盘覆盖。有没有办法将bottomsheet移到键盘上方?Padding(padding:EdgeInsets.only(bottom:MediaQuery.of(context).viewInsets.bottom),child:Column(children:[TextField(autofocus:true,decoration:InputDecoration(hintText:'Title'),),TextField(decoration:InputDecoration(hintText:'
在横向模式下显示底部工作表对话框时出现错误行为。该问题出现在24.+版本的设计库中。根据下图,底页仅在横向中未正确显示。我正在使用BottomSheetDialog类,并且正在学习本教程:http://www.skholingua.com/blog/bottom-sheet-android,在我发布的应用程序中也会出现问题。我测试了25.+版本,问题没有解决。横向24、25.+库中的错误23.+库中的相同示例主要ActivitypublicclassMainActivityextendsAppCompatActivity{CoordinatorLayoutcoordinatorLayo
在横向模式下显示底部工作表对话框时出现错误行为。该问题出现在24.+版本的设计库中。根据下图,底页仅在横向中未正确显示。我正在使用BottomSheetDialog类,并且正在学习本教程:http://www.skholingua.com/blog/bottom-sheet-android,在我发布的应用程序中也会出现问题。我测试了25.+版本,问题没有解决。横向24、25.+库中的错误23.+库中的相同示例主要ActivitypublicclassMainActivityextendsAppCompatActivity{CoordinatorLayoutcoordinatorLayo
问题我正在使用(非常)新的AngularJSMaterialDesigndependency设计一个Cordova混合应用程序.我在通过$mdBottomSheet服务调用的底部表单中有一个登录表单。示例如下:$scope.showLogin=function($event){$mdBottomSheet.show({templateUrl:'views/login/login.html',controller:'loginCtrl'})};views/login/login.html的内容是:Signin一切正常运行和显示。但是!当我去点击输入时,焦点永远不会给予输入,而是md-bo
是否可以在此showModalBottomSheet上设置title和导航返回按钮?我期待这样的事情...... 最佳答案 是的,在Flutter中可以做类似的事情。您可以使用ColumnWidget并将其第一个子元素作为标题栏或类似标题和后退箭头图标的东西。代码如下:import'dart:async';import'package:flutter/material.dart';voidmain()=>runApp(MyApp());classMyAppextendsStatelessWidget{@overrideWidgetb
是否可以在此showModalBottomSheet上设置title和导航返回按钮?我期待这样的事情...... 最佳答案 是的,在Flutter中可以做类似的事情。您可以使用ColumnWidget并将其第一个子元素作为标题栏或类似标题和后退箭头图标的东西。代码如下:import'dart:async';import'package:flutter/material.dart';voidmain()=>runApp(MyApp());classMyAppextendsStatelessWidget{@overrideWidgetb
有没有一种方法可以让Exhibitionbottomsheet仅在用户位于指定选项卡上时可见,而对于其他选项卡则不可见。代码-Tabs(refresh:()=>setState((){})),value==0?Center(child:AboutPage()):Container(),value==1?Center(child:Sliding()):Container(),value==2?Center(child:CoveragePage()):Container(),],),),ExhibitionBottomSheet()在上面的代码中,ExhibitionBottomSheet
我想在点击谷歌地图标记时带上一个模态底页,并使用flutter显示一些动态数据 最佳答案 您可以对标记的onTap事件进行编程以显示模式底页:finalMarkermarker=Marker(markerId:markerId,position:LatLng(lat,lon),onTap:(){controller.animateCamera(CameraUpdate.newCameraPosition(newCameraPosition(target:LatLng(lat,lon),zoom:18)));showModalBott
在我的代码中,我调用了一个底部工作表来显示一个图block列表。这些磁贴包含显示snackbar的按钮。该功能运行良好,唯一的问题是snackbar显示在底部工作表后面,因此只有关闭底部工作表才能看到它。它们中的每一个都使用以下代码调用:1。底页:void_settingModalBottomSheet(context,stream,scaffoldKey){if(_availableRides.length==0){returnnull;}else{returnscaffoldKey.currentState.showBottomSheet((context){returnColum